The Associate Director, R&D Quality Regulatory & Risk Integration is responsible for establishing, implementing, and maturing the R&D Quality Regulatory Intelligence & Surveillance (RI&S) process within RDQ and serving as the main quality point of contact for Regulatory Affairs. This role serves as the strategic integration point between external regulatory intelligence, proactive quality risk management, governance processes, and inspection readiness activities across R&D Quality. The role partners closely with Global Regulatory Intelligence & Surveillance functions, RDQ leadership, Quality System Owners, Regulatory Affairs, and other cross-functional stakeholders to ensure emerging regulatory expectations, inspection trends, enforcement actions, and industry signals are proactively translated into actionable RDQ risk, governance, and operational activities. This individual will serve as the RDQ Regulatory Intelligence Champion (RIC) within enterprise Regulatory Intelligence forums and Centers of Excellence and will represent the Regulatory Intelligence Quality System within RDQ governance forums including the RDQ Quality Leadership Team (QLT), Quality Management Review (QMR), Monthly Risk Review Forum, and operational governance meetings. The Associate Director will serve as a quality business partner to Regulatory Affairs functions and be the resource for quality consults, process improvement initiatives, quality events, and inspection readiness activities. This position sits within the R&D Governance & Risk Management organization and plays a key role in advancing proactive, risk-based governance and inspection readiness capabilities across RDQ.
